Representatives from Frontier Waste argued overloaded commercial dumpsters create public‑health risks; council approved a $50 overage charge and adopted multiple master fee schedule updates including park fees and a non‑potable water rate.

The City of Cleveland voted April 21 to adopt a $50 overage fee for commercial waste containers and to update the city's master fee schedule.
